What Texas Employers Look For

The qualifications that appear most often in field application engineer jobs across Texas.

  • Bachelor's degree in electrical engineering, computer engineering, or a closely related technical field
  • Hands-on experience with the product lines or technology platforms the employer sells
  • Ability to deliver technical demonstrations, proofs of concept, and customer training sessions
  • Strong troubleshooting skills for hardware and software integration in customer environments
  • Willingness to travel regularly to customer sites across Texas and surrounding regions
  • Familiarity with CRM tools and technical pre-sales or post-sales support workflows

How do you become a field application engineer in Texas?

Most field application engineer roles in Texas require a bachelor's degree in electrical engineering, computer engineering, or a related discipline, and Texas does not require a state-issued engineering license for this role because it is not a licensed professional engineering position. Employers typically look for candidates who combine technical depth in a specific product area, such as semiconductors or industrial controls, with customer-facing communication skills. Graduating from a Texas engineering program and building hands-on lab or internship experience with a major manufacturer gives candidates a strong starting point.

How much do field application engineers make in Texas?

Field application engineers in Texas earn a median of about $130,610 a year, based on May 2025 Bureau of Labor Statistics wage data, ranging from around $78,730 for the lowest 10% to over $201,850 for the top 10%. Pay rises with experience, specialty, and employer.

Are there remote field application engineer jobs in Texas?

Yes, but they're less common than in purely analytical roles because field application engineers routinely travel to customer sites for demonstrations and troubleshooting. About 9% of field application engineer openings tied to Texas are remote or hybrid as of June 2026, and those remote-eligible positions tend to cover technical pre-sales support, documentation, and virtual training rather than on-site installation or hands-on commissioning work.

How can I get hired as a field application engineer in Texas with little or no experience?

The most realistic entry path is a technical support or applications intern role at a Texas-based semiconductor or industrial automation company, where you build product knowledge before stepping into a full field role. Companies such as Texas Instruments and Molex run new-grad and associate applications engineer programs specifically designed for candidates without field experience. Moving laterally from a test engineer, systems integration technician, or applications lab role is also a proven route, and earning a relevant certification, such as a Certified Electronics Technician credential, strengthens a resume when direct field experience is thin.
